  • Original language description

    A new tabletop confocal micro-XRF setup was designed at the Department of Dosimetry and Application of Ionizing Radiation of the Czech Technical University in Prague. In this setup, the first polycapillary lens is coupled to the X-ray source (X-Beam Superflux PF manufactured by XOS). The second lens is placed on a motorized x-y-z stage. Thus, it is possible to study the properties of the probing volume in dependence on a mutual position of both polycapillary lenses. The space resolution of the setup andX-ray fluorescence count rate was measured in dependence on the position of the second lens. The results of the measurement may be useful for searching for the right adjustment of the confocal micro-XRF setup.
